Re: [Elecraft] Spam filtering
That did used to happen with brute-force algorithms. For the past 15 years or more, spam filtering has been an arms race. Spammers automiatically open a bunch of email accounts on a free provider, then have scripts try different variations until something would get through. Then they hammer the service with that spam until it was blocked. Then try again. Spam can evolve hour-by-hour to find weaknesses in the algorithms. Similar stuff happens with spiders for web search engines. [Elecraft] Spam filtering
Before the authorities close this useful but somewhat-OT thread, I would share one anecdote told to me to be true, though I can't personally vouch for it, about an unnamed university twenty-plus years ago. The IT department decided to install filters that would block both incoming and outgoing e-mail that contained offensive language. So they made up a dirty words list, not telling any of the clients what was on it or even that it existed. It was discovered when the Political Science Department got no responses to its e-blast announcement of a conference titled something like "Contemporary Issues in Capitalism, Socialism, and Communitarianism." The word Socialism contains the word Cialis. Or so the story goes. Re: [Elecraft] KPA1500 new software 1.87
John, I just went thru this and reverted back to the original fan profile with the ^FP0 command using the KPA 1500 utility. What is not mentioned in the release notes is that after you execute this command, you must power cycle the KPA 1500. After that you will have the new firmware with the old fan profile.
